The Quick Ship gas springs that are supplied from stock are available in stainless steel and steel versions. The piston rod of the steel gas springs is provided with a CeramPro® coating and the cylinder jacket is made of powder-coated steel. In the stainless steel version, the piston rod and cylinder jacket are made of stainless steel 316L.
The gas springs are available in various sizes. The piston rod diameters of the two series can, for instance, vary from 6 to 14 mm and the cylinder jackets from 15 to 28 mm (read: 6/15, 8/19, 10/22, 14/28). Depending on the selected model, the stroke can vary from 20 to 750 mm and the force can vary from 10 to 2,600 N. If desired, the above-mentioned gas springs can be fully customized. In that case, the stroke and end damping, among other things, can be fully customized. Bansbach gas springs
BIBUS is a distributor of the German Bansbach gas springs and actuators. The gas springs are ISO 9001: 2008 certified and can be used in various industrial applications. In addition to industrial applications, the gas springs are often used in the medical sector, in shipbuilding, in machine and equipment construction, in bodywork construction, but also in home applications, such as for a floor hatch.
The friction with the Bansbach gas springs is minimal thanks to the use of plastic plain bearings and because the steel piston rod is coated. All models have an integrated valve for draining or refilling the gas spring with nitrogen as standard. Optionally, this can be carried out in the workshop at BIBUS or optionally a refill or drain set can be supplied, so that this operation can be carried out entirely in-house.
The entire package of Quick Ship gas springs can be used at temperatures from -30 ° to a maximum of + 80 ° C.
